diff --git a/res/templates/notif.html b/res/templates/notif.html index bdff2786ff249f430c514859f3a48156d428afaf..70f56553522c33a0fbd7fc9209e15fb83935c022 100644 --- a/res/templates/notif.html +++ b/res/templates/notif.html @@ -18,13 +18,11 @@ <div class="message_time">{{ message.ts|format_ts("%H:%M") }}</div> <div class="message_body"> {% if message.msgtype == "m.text" %} - {% if message.format == "org.matrix.custom.html" %} - {{ message.body_text_html }} - {% else %} - {{ message.body_text_plain }} - {% endif %} + {{ message.body_text_html }} {% elif message.msgtype == "m.image" %} <img src="{{ message.image_url|mxc_to_http(640, 480, scale) }}" /> + {% elif message.msgtype == "m.file" %} + <span class="filename">{{ message.body_text_plain }}</span> {% endif %} </div> </div> diff --git a/synapse/push/mailer.py b/synapse/push/mailer.py index e6554dc7fdb51ccce4b9d89299cda86019cb6942..60a4878a3ed0c2de68d9e2346c3a6136fc2a05d5 100644 --- a/synapse/push/mailer.py +++ b/synapse/push/mailer.py @@ -222,8 +222,9 @@ class Mailer(object): self.add_text_message_vars(ret, event) elif event.content["msgtype"] == "m.image": self.add_image_message_vars(ret, event) - else: - return None + + if "body" in event.content: + ret["body_text_plain"] = event.content["body"] return ret